BURLINGTON, Vt. – Vermont men's soccer fifth year
Alex Nagy has been added to the NCAA Division I Player's to Watch List, joining teammates
Noah Egan and
Nate Silveira. The United Soccer Coaches are in the midst of releasing its watch list by position for the upcoming season, with one final announcement coming on Aug. 16.

Nagy is one of three America East midfielders on the Player's to Watch List. The Bow, N.H. native led the Catamounts last season with 20 points and 10 assists, earning All-Conference First Team and All-Region First Team. Nagy finished the season ranked No. 10 in the country in assists. The midfielder was selected by DC United in the second round of the 2022 MLS SuperDraft
Egan is the lone America East defender on the list. A stalwart on the back line for the Catamounts, Egan started in all 19 games last season and contributed to Vermont's impressive 0.95 goals against average and nine clean sheets. The Irvine, Calif. native was named to the America East All-Conference First Team and the United Soccer Coaches All-Region First Team.
Silveira is one of six goalkeepers named to the watch list, which consists of All-Americans and first or second team All-Region players from 2021, who are set to return for the 2022 season. The East Providence, R.I. helped guide Vermont to a conference championship in 2021. Silveira became the third Catamount in program history to be named America East Goalkeeper of the Year, posting a 0.84 goals against average, .771 save percentage, and eight shutouts. He was credited with 13 wins last season, which is the second highest single-season total in program history.
Picked No. 2 in the America East Preseason Poll, the Catamounts begin the 2022 campaign on the road at Merrimack on Aug. 25. UVM will then host the first of 10 home games at Virtue Field this season on Aug. 30 against Quinnipiac. The home opener kicks off at 7 p.m.
